Can I cancel my credit card if it is not activated?
Yes, I can cancel my credit card if it is not activated. Applicants can go to the business outlets of the issuing bank to cancel their credit cards with their ID cards and credit cards to be sold, or they can call the customer service hotline of the issuing bank and turn to manual customer service to apply for cancellation of credit cards. The cancelled cards need to be properly kept, and should not be discarded at will to prevent others from stealing credit cards or personal information.

the credit card billing date means that the issuing bank will regularly summarize and settle all transactions and expenses in your credit card account in the current period every month, calculate the total amount owed and the minimum repayment amount in the current period, and mail the statement for you. This date is the billing statement of your credit card. Credit card repayment date refers to the latest date when the issuing bank (or institution) requires the cardholder to repay the payable amount.
a few days after the bank credit card issues the bill, each bank's credit card will agree on a billing date and a repayment date, in which the billing date is the date when the credit card issues the bill, and the repayment date is what we call the final repayment date. After the credit card is billed, it can be repaid between the billing date and the repayment date. The billing date of the credit card is the day when the bill is issued, and the repayment date is the final repayment date. Users can repay within this period of time, and the repayment must be completed on the repayment date at the latest.

the credit card has not been activated. can I cancel it?
Preface: Credit card is an item that we often use when handling banking business, so if the opened credit card is not activated, can it be cancelled? If possible, what cancellation procedures are needed? Let's take a look with Xiaobian!
1. Deactivated credit cards can also be cancelled
Credit cards can also be cancelled if they are not activated by users. Besides specific credit cards, such as platinum cards, the cancellation of ordinary credit cards will generally not charge any fees and will not affect personal credit.
second, how to cancel the credit card
if you want to cancel the inactive credit card, you can cancel it by telephone, at outlets and at designated places. Credit card holders can call the customer service phone number of the relevant bank to apply for cancellation. At the same time, cardholders can also bring their ID cards and credit cards to the designated outlets of the bank for cancellation. This cancellation method needs to fill in the relevant cancellation application form. The bank will report a copy of the cardholder's identity and the cancellation application form to the bank's headquarters. Can the real cardholder call at the time notified by the bank to verify whether his credit card has been cancelled successfully? The bank cards of a few banks need to be cancelled at the place designated by the due bank. Different banks have different regulations, and cardholders can consult the customer service of the bank to cancel the business.

a credit card, also known as a debit card, is a credit certificate issued by a commercial bank or credit card company to a consumer with qualified credit. It is in the form of a card with the name, expiration date, number and cardholder's name printed on the front, and a magnetic stripe and signature strip on the back.
consumers with credit cards can go to the special commercial service department for shopping or spending, and then the bank will settle accounts with merchants and cardholders, and cardholders can overdraw within the prescribed limit.
The credit card stipulated in the relevant laws of our country (Interpretation of the NPC Standing Committee on the Provisions on Credit Cards) refers to the electronic payment card issued by commercial banks or other financial institutions with all or some functions such as consumer payment, credit loan, transfer settlement, cash deposit and withdrawal.

in p>1915, credit cards originated in America. The earliest institutions that issued credit cards were not banks, but some department stores, restaurants, entertainment industries and gasoline companies.
In order to attract customers, promote products and expand turnover, some shops and restaurants in the United States selectively gave customers a kind of credit chip similar to a metal badge, which later evolved into a card made of plastic as a proof of customers' purchase and consumption, and launched the credit service of purchasing goods at this firm or company or gas station with the credit chip. Customers can buy goods on credit at these chip-issuing shops and their semicolons and pay for them on schedule. This is the prototype of credit card.
